Sen. Elizabeth Warren’s (D-MA) presidential campaign reported paying a whopping 160 employees in the first three months of 2019, according to a PAY DIRT review of Federal Election Commission records, giving her by far the biggest salaried staff of any Democratic presidential contender.

The next biggest presidential campaign staff belonged to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-VT), who reported paying 86 employees in the first quarter.
